How long do 2014 Hyundai Elantra Coupe rotors last?
- Rotor life depends on driving habits, environment, and pad material; many drivers see 30,000–70,000 miles under normal conditions.

Do you have to replace brake pads and rotors at the same time on a 2014 Hyundai Elantra Coupe?
- Not always, but replacing pads and rotors together delivers optimal braking, reduces noise, and prevents accelerated wear.

What are the signs of bad brake rotors?
- Vibrations, pulsation in the brake pedal, visible grooves or scoring, and unusual noise are common signs; bring your vehicle in for inspection right away.

What is the difference between resurfacing and replacing brake rotors?
- Resurfacing smooths minor imperfections to restore even contact if the rotor is within thickness specs; replacement is required when wear or damage exceeds safe limits.

Front and Rear Brake Rotors
On a 2014 Hyundai Elantra Coupe, front and rear rotors serve the same purpose—convert kinetic energy into heat to slow the vehicle—but the front rotors typically do more work. Because braking forces transfer weight forward, front rotors tend to absorb more heat and wear faster than the rear rotors. That means front rotors often require resurfacing or replacement sooner.
